• 締切済み

JPEGとMPEGでの圧縮後データ量の比較

ボードカメラで撮像した連続画像を、1枚1枚JPEG圧縮する場合の合計と、1つのMPEG画像に圧縮する場合、どちらが小さなファイルサイズになるか見当をつけたいと考えています。 どんな画像にもよるかと思いますので、VGA 640 x 480 pixel, 8 bit color, 30 fps, 30秒間 で、カメラは固定して(背景はほとんど動かない)画面サイズの1/4くらいの大きさの物体が、右から左へ移動する、とした場合、各々どのくらいのファイルサイズになるか、だいたいの見当はつきませんでしょうか?

みんなの回答

  • trytobe
  • ベストアンサー率36% (3457/9591)
回答No.1

MPEG が動画を小さいサイズに圧縮する技術には、「時間が経ってもほとんど変化がない部分は、最初の静止画のまま、という表示でも人間は気づかないから2枚目以降からは大胆に省略する」という技術があります。 そのため、ご質問のようにカメラが固定されて、背景もほとんど動かないものだと、背景のデータは最初の静止画のデータ以外は、大胆に背景部分を省略して、それ以外の変化している物体の周辺だけをデータに重点的に残します。 JPEG画像も、画質に応じてファイルサイズを削減できるか否かが決まりますから、ファイルサイズを想定することは困難です。そして、MPEG で30枚/秒×30秒=900枚のうち、変化がない3/4のエリアは2枚/秒×30秒=60枚くらいに圧縮でき、残り1/4の物体とその周辺は900枚と見ても、JPEG の枚数に換算して 60枚×3/4 + 900枚×1/4 = 270枚分程度には収まるかと思います。

jaipur
質問者

お礼

お返事遅くなり、申し訳ありません。 おっしゃる通り、ファイルサイズの見積もりは画像の内容に大きく依存するので難しいのだろうと思います。 そんな中、JPEG, MPEGでのファイルサイズの比較をわかりやすく解説していただき、どうもありがとうございました。